2025 Compare Climate & Weather:
Rio Rancho, NM vs Chandler, AZ

Change Cities
Highlights

On average, there are 297 sunny days per year in Chandler. Rio Rancho averages 273 sunny days per year. The US average is 205 sunny days.

Chandler, Arizona gets 9 inches of rain, on average, per year. Rio Rancho, New Mexico gets 12 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38.1 inches of rain per year.

Chandler averages 0 inches of snow per year. Rio Rancho averages 10.1 inches of snow per year. The US average is 27.8 inches of snow per year.

July is the hottest month for Rio Rancho with an average high temperature of 93.6°, which ranks it as warmer than most places in New Mexico. In Rio Rancho, there are 4 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Rio Rancho are May, October and April.

July is the hottest month for Chandler with an average high temperature of 105.3°, which ranks it as warmer than most places in Arizona. In Chandler, there are 3 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Chandler are March, November and February.
January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Rio Rancho with an average of 21.5°. This is warmer than most places in New Mexico.

December has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Chandler with an average of 39.4°. This is warmer than most places in Arizona.

In Rio Rancho, there are 68.6 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is hotter than most places in New Mexico.

In Chandler, there are 168.8 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is hotter than most places in Arizona.

In Rio Rancho, there are 126.6 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is warmer than most places in New Mexico.

In Chandler, there are 11.3 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is warmer than most places in Arizona.

In Rio Rancho,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is warmer than most places in New Mexico.

In Chandler,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is about average compared to other places in Arizona.

August is the wettest month in Rio Rancho with 2.0 inches of rain, and the driest month is February with 0.5 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 38% of yearly precipitation and 15% occurs in Spring,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 12.0 inches in Rio Rancho means that it is about average compared to other places in New Mexico.


August is the wettest month in Chandler with 1.2 inches of rain, and the driest month is June with 0.0 inches. The wettest season is Spring with 36% of yearly precipitation and 17% occurs in Summer,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 9.0 inches in Chandler means that it is drier than most places in Arizona.

August is the rainiest month in Rio Rancho with 8.0 days of rain, and November is the driest month with only 2.7 rainy days. There are 50.3 rainy days annually in Rio Rancho, which is less rainy than most places in New Mexico. The rainiest season is Autumn when it rains 36% of the time and the driest is Spring with only a 19% chance of a rainy day.

August is the rainiest month in Chandler with 4.5 days of rain, and June is the driest month with only 0.5 rainy days. There are 34.6 rainy days annually in Chandler, which is less rainy than most places in Arizona.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 35% of the time and the driest is Summer with only a 18% chance of a rainy day.

An annual snowfall of 10.1 inches in Rio Rancho means that it is about average compared to other places in New Mexico.

There is rarely any recorded snowfall in Chandler, ranking it as one of the least snowy places in Arizona.
December is the snowiest month in Rio Rancho with 2.9 inches of snow, and 6 months of the year have significant snowfall.

Any measurable snowfall is a rare occurance in Chandler.

DID YOU KNOW?

Many people confuse Weather and Climate, but they are different. Weather ref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, while Climate ref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a long period of time.

Weather, more specifically, refers to how the atmosphere behaves and its effects on life and human activities. Most people think of Weather in terms of what can be observed: temperature, humidity, precipitation, and cloudy/sunny conditions. Weather conditions constantly change on a minute-to-minute basis.

Climate is a record of the average weather conditions for a given place over a long period of time, often referred to as Climate Normals. A 30-year period of record is a common requirement to be considered a Climate Normal.
